    History & Etymology

    Angel-Gabriel is a compound name combining 'Angel' and 'Gabriel'. 'Angel' derives from the Greek word 'angelos' (ἄγγελος), meaning 'messenger'. It became associated with celestial beings in religious contexts. 'Gabriel' is a Hebrew name, Gavri'el (גַּבְרִיאֵל), meaning 'God is my strength' or 'man of God'. Gabriel is a prominent archangel in Abrahamic religions, known for delivering important messages, such as the Annunciation to Mary.

    The combination of these two names emphasizes the themes of divine message and strength. While both names have ancient roots, their hyphenated combination is a more modern phenomenon, often chosen to give a child a unique and deeply spiritual name, drawing on the significance of both components.
